本内容介绍了IO模拟串口通讯的实现方法及实例分析
上传时间: 2013-11-11
上传用户:jiwy
摘要! 就如何使用单片机对旋转增量编码器鉴相进行了研究! 给出了常用的鉴相算法以及识 别"毛刺#的方法!并通过在!AVR单片机上编程验证了所给出的鉴相方法$ 更多编码器知识请访问http://www.elecfans.com/zhuanti/20111111242149.html
上传时间: 2013-11-16
上传用户:wojiaohs
在前面我们已经学习了1602 和12864 液晶的基本知识,并且通过简单的实例实现了 在1602和12864液晶上显示字符和汉字。今天我们再来学习另外一种比较常用的液晶12232. 本实例中我们选用深圳锦昌电子的DM12232B型液晶。 本实例分为三个功能模块,分别描述如下: ● 单片机系统:利用ATmega16 单片机与DM12232B型液晶构成液晶显示电路。 ● 外围电路:DM12232B型液晶与单片机的连接电路。 ● 软件程序:编写软件,控制液晶显示字符。 通过本实例的学习,掌握以下内容: ● 掌握 DM12232B型液晶的基本原理和程序设计方法。
标签: CEPARK-AVR 12232 LCD 单片机教程
上传时间: 2013-10-19
上传用户:nanshan
由于C语言的结构性和模块化,采用C语言编写的程序容易阅读和维护,还有很好的可移植性。本文介绍一种用C语言实现的LCD多级菜单的方法,该方法已成功应用在煤矿安全监测设备上。 1、硬件环境及LCD菜单实现的功能 2、程序设计 3、结语
上传时间: 2014-01-08
上传用户:gonuiln
提出一种基于凌阳单片机的步进电机加减速的控制方法。采用凌阳科技推出的16位结构工控单片机SPMC75F2413A为控制器,由Allegro公司生产的两相步进电机专用驱动器件SLA7042M构成步进电机的驱动电路,在传统的3段直线加减速控制算法基础上增加至7段S形曲线加减速过程,控制步进电机的启动和停止。实验结果表明,该控制方法克服了直线加减速中不连续、易造成系统冲击的问题,整个系统实现柔性控制,电机启动、停止连续性能提高30%。 Abstract: The method of controlled stepping motor is referred based on SPMC75F2413A MCU, which adopts the 16 knots SPMC75F2413A MCU as the controller. The special-purpose actuation chip SLA7042M of two stepping motor produced by Allegro Corporation constituted to actuation electric circuit. The purpose of increasing to seven section of S shape curve based on the traditional three sections of straight line is to control the start and stop process of stepping motor. The experimental results show that the control method solves easy to pull-out and overshot problems. The overall system realizes flexible control, and the performance of motor start or stop continuity is increased 30%
上传时间: 2013-12-08
上传用户:jiangfire
单片机作为一种微型计算机,其内部具有一定的存储单元(8031除外),但由于其内部存储单元及端口有限,很多情况下难以满足实际需求。为此介绍一种新的扩展方法,将数据线与地址线合并使用,通过软件控制的方法实现数据线与地址线功能的分时转换,数据线不仅用于传送数据信号,还可作为地址线、控制线,用于传送地址信号和控制信号,从而实现单片机与存储器件的有效连接。以单片机片外256KB数据存储空间的扩展为例,通过该扩展方法,仅用10个I/O端口便可实现,与传统的扩展方法相比,可节约8个I/O端口。 Abstract: As a micro-computer,the SCM internal memory has a certain units(except8031),but because of its internal storage units and the ports are limited,in many cases it can not meet the actual demand.So we introduced a new extension method,the data line and address lines combined through software-controlled approach to realize the time-conversion functions of data lines and address lines,so the data lines not only transmited data signals,but also served as address lines and control lines to transmit address signals and control signals,in order to achieve an effective connection of microcontroller and memory chips.Take microcontroller chip with256KB of data storage space expansion as example,through this extension method,with only10I/O ports it was achieved,compared with the traditional extension methods,this method saves8I/O ports.
上传时间: 2014-12-26
上传用户:adada
前言 单片机是一门实践性很强的课程,实验是教学中非常重要的环节。为了适应教学的需要,我们编写了这本5013S单片机原理及应用实验指导书。 本实验指导由软件实验和硬件实验两部分组成。第一部分包括系统功能简介、键盘监控使用简介等方面的内容,旨在使学生对实验系统有大致全面的了解,掌握实验设备的使用方法,熟悉微机实验系统的结构、硬件连接方式。第二部分包括软件实验和硬件实验内容,实验项目完整丰富,与课堂教学紧密结合,充分激发了学生的动手及思维能力,有效提高了实验效率、实验成功率和教学质量。 本实验指导由王玉巧编写,吕运朋主审,在编写过程中得到了院长的精心指导,电子专业教研室的同志也给予了大力相助,由于编写时间仓促,难免出现个别问题,希望各位专家多给予批评指正。
上传时间: 2013-10-28
上传用户:leesuper
摘要:在工业自动控制中,单片机与PLC的远距离通信是一个难点与热点问题。本文设计了S7-200PLC与PIC16F877单片机实现远距离串行通信的硬件连接和软件实现方法。本文采用了MAX485E芯片进行TTL电平与差分信号之间的转换,使用RS-485端口和半双工模式进行通信。最后通过异或校验码对接收到的数据进行核对,以进一步提高数据传输的可靠性。实验证明,该方法成功实现了单片机与PLC的远距离通信,并且具有开发简单,抗干扰能力强的特点,具有一定实用价值。关键词:单片机 PLC 串行通信
上传时间: 2014-12-27
上传用户:YUANQINHUI
介绍了采用ATmega48单片机实现三相无刷直流电机控制器的方法。利用Atmega48获得带死区的脉宽调制(PWM)、霍尔传感器的换相处理、正弦驱动信号的产生和电机转速的控制等功能。采用该方法的优点是所需的外围器件少,成本低。 Abstract: The method of 3-phase brushless DC motor control based on ATmega48 is presented in this paper.The system uses ATmega48 to generate PWM signals with dead-time, hall sensors signals commutation,sine driving signal and rotational speed of motor.Using this method,the needed external devices are few, the cost is low.
上传时间: 2013-12-09
上传用户:330402686
前面介绍了单片机的基本结构、功能及其扩展和基本外围设备的接口技术。从单片机应用系统设计的角度看,这些内容仅使我们掌握了单片机的工作状态,或者说,使我们掌握了单片机所提供的软件和硬件资源,以及怎样合理地使用这些资源。这为单片机应用系统设计奠定了基础。除此之外,一个实际的单片机应用系统除需要进行多种配置及其接口连接外,还会涉及到更为复杂的内容和问题,多种类型的电路结构(模拟电路、伺服驱动电路、抗干扰隔离电路等)。因此,单片机应用系统设计应遵循一些基本原则和方法。从一般应用角度来说,了解单片机应用系统的结构、设计的内容与一般方法,对于单片机应用系统的工程设计与开发有着十分重要的指导意义。
上传时间: 2013-11-23
上传用户:猫爱薛定谔